Hi,
You can also set Auth-Type and then add an entry in authentication
section like you did in authorize.
it could look like this :
in users files:
user ...,Autz-Type := aldap1, Auth-Type := aldap1
and in radiusd.conf:
Authorize{
...
Autz-Type aldap1 {
...
}
...
}

If you use users file with a User-Password, you don't have to use ntlm
in MSCHAP config because it's only here to deal with a Windows domain
Controller.
